1962 Season Highlights
 Cliff Coggins enters his 1st season as Head Coach at Buckhorn.
 
1962 Season
 Date   Opponent  Score   
 Fri., Sep. 7   Sparkman    12   0   W       
 Fri., Sep. 14   Courtland    13   0   W       
 Fri., Sep. 21   Tanner    41   21   W       
 Fri., Sep. 28   New Hope    13   0   W       
 Thu., Oct. 4   Ardmore    25   20   W       
 Fri., Oct. 12  @ Elkmont    47   0   W       
 Fri., Oct. 19   Sparkman    21   18   W       
 Fri., Oct. 26   Falkville    32   0   W       
 Fri., Nov. 2   Huntland TN    32   6   W       
 Tue., Nov. 13   Sparkman    20   32   L       
 
1962 Season Totals
  Record9-1
  Points Scored256
  Scoring Average25.6
  Points Allowed97
  Defense Average9.7
  Opponents Record31-50
  Home Record0-0
  Away Record1-0

Great Moments in Alabama High School Football History

From 1947 until his retirement in 1992 Glenn Daniel's teams won 302 games at Pine Hill and Luverne. He was the winningest coach in state history until 2010.
